Chicago Students Defy the Odds

Chicago Students Defy the Odds

Four years ago, Tim King, CEO and founder of Urban Prep Academy, led a group of like-minded education, business, and civic leaders to found Chicago’s only public all-male, all-African American high school. Their mission was clear: to get all their graduates into a four-year college or university.

South Central Scholars Support STEM Success

Of students that started out majoring in STEM in 2004 who then went on to graduate with a STEM degree, only 18% are black. That compares with 22% of Latino students; 33%, whites; and 42%, Asian Americans, according to UCLA’s Higher Education Research Institute.
